Size: a a a

2020 May 28

p

pragus in Go-go!
источник

S

Skill in Go-go!
Есть тут эксперты по гпу в го? Нужно переписать цикл или хотя бы sha256 на него
источник

DY

Dmitriy Yakovlev in Go-go!
Ребята, как строку из request.body, содержащую символы вида \x1f, преобразовать в обычную строку чтобы json decoder смог прочитать?
источник

DP

Daniel Podolsky in Go-go!
Skill
Есть тут эксперты по гпу в го? Нужно переписать цикл или хотя бы sha256 на него
Зачем?!
источник

DY

Dmitriy Yakovlev in Go-go!
перебирать все символы явно неверно, должен быть какой-то встроенный механизм
источник

p

pragus in Go-go!
Skill
Есть тут эксперты по гпу в го? Нужно переписать цикл или хотя бы sha256 на него
по какой gpu?
источник

S

Skill in Go-go!
Daniel Podolsky
Зачем?!
Скрипт выступает в роли сервера, соответственно отвечает на 200 потоках очень медленно. На 1 запрос в среднем 50000 итераций sha256. Подумал что гпу будет с этим намного быстрее справляться
источник

S

Skill in Go-go!
К тому же сама входная строка для хеширования около 200 символов
источник

ВГ

Владимир Гришин... in Go-go!
Skill
Скрипт выступает в роли сервера, соответственно отвечает на 200 потоках очень медленно. На 1 запрос в среднем 50000 итераций sha256. Подумал что гпу будет с этим намного быстрее справляться
не будет, потому что расчет SHA - последовательная процедура
источник

DP

Daniel Podolsky in Go-go!
Владимир Гришин
не будет, потому что расчет SHA - последовательная процедура
на gpu обычно существенно больше ядер
источник

ВГ

Владимир Гришин... in Go-go!
но передача данных туда-сюда съест весь выигрыш
источник

DP

Daniel Podolsky in Go-go!
я так понял - соответствующие тулзы есть для CUDA

и надо просто нарисовать взаимодействие - например, через сокеты
источник

ВГ

Владимир Гришин... in Go-go!
(но это теорикрафт)
источник

ВГ

Владимир Гришин... in Go-go!
для куды можно взять gorgonia например
источник

AK

Andrey Kartashov in Go-go!
Skill
Скрипт выступает в роли сервера, соответственно отвечает на 200 потоках очень медленно. На 1 запрос в среднем 50000 итераций sha256. Подумал что гпу будет с этим намного быстрее справляться
источник

AK

Andrey Kartashov in Go-go!
я бы посмотрел в сторону https://github.com/minio/sha256-simd
источник

VS

Viktor Suprun in Go-go!
всем привет) блин, стоит ливнуть из какого то тематического канала, как спустя непродолжительное время снова начинаешь работать по этой тематике и возвращаешься...

у меня тут сегодня внезапно возник вопрос, почему в го форматирование тайма сделано конкретной датой? точнее, что значит эта дата? я чет устал гуглить :D
почему так сделано есть у меня предположение, и вполне логичное... но почему именно 2 января 06 15:04?)
источник

DM

Dmitry M in Go-go!
Skill
Скрипт выступает в роли сервера, соответственно отвечает на 200 потоках очень медленно. На 1 запрос в среднем 50000 итераций sha256. Подумал что гпу будет с этим намного быстрее справляться
источник

DP

Daniel Podolsky in Go-go!
Viktor Suprun
всем привет) блин, стоит ливнуть из какого то тематического канала, как спустя непродолжительное время снова начинаешь работать по этой тематике и возвращаешься...

у меня тут сегодня внезапно возник вопрос, почему в го форматирование тайма сделано конкретной датой? точнее, что значит эта дата? я чет устал гуглить :D
почему так сделано есть у меня предположение, и вполне логичное... но почему именно 2 января 06 15:04?)
это как бы индексы позиции соответствующего элемента в эталонной строке
источник

S

Skill in Go-go!
То есть быстрее никак не сделать? А то с такой скоростью особого смысла нет
источник